**Q: My review environment can't open the Graphlume dependency visualizer — what now?**

A: Graphlume locks its render cache after three failed sync attempts. Don't regenerate the graph manually; stale edges will confuse the diff overlay. Instead, reset the cache from the reviewer console and, when prompted, enter the recovery passphrase provided below.

strongbox words: wenwyn-novok-belys-ulamir-olidor-fraeth

// Deep-link routing for the Quellbird mobile apps.
// Every inbound link is matched against the route table, then
// retried against the fallback resolver if no match lands.
// Don't hardcode paths elsewhere; register them here.
// Timeouts and retry caps are tuned per platform review.
// Current constants follow below.

constants for tagef-kagug:
QUOTAS = {
    "ulaix": 10,
    "holwyn": 2,
}

## Data Stores — Consent Banner Rollout

Quick orientation for review: the Nimbly consent banner writes opt-in events to its own little store rather than the main app DB, so we can purge it independently when legal asks. Reads go through a five-minute cache, so don't panic if the UI lags a toggle. Schema migrations live in `consent/migrations`. For local verification of the reviewer checklist, connect to the staging consent store with the string below.

primary connection of tawif-yajeg = postgresql://rusiel_svc:G879q9cx6GsSvj@db-dd9f.norvagrid.internal:5432/casath

Finance Review Summary — Project Lanthorn Delay

For the incoming director: Project Lanthorn, our internal billing migration, is now eleven weeks behind schedule. Cost overrun stands at 14% against the approved envelope, driven chiefly by contractor rework and a late scope change from the Dunmere office. A revised plan has been drafted and independently checked. The rationale for how we proceed is captured in the confidential note that follows.

board note of kagep-yahig: Only 9 of the 120 pilot accounts renewed Quenix, so a churn review is set for April 1.